With 4 weeks to go until the best Masters rowers in the country hit the water in Perth for the 2026 Australian Masters Rowing Championships (AMRC), the interest from across Australia is growing.
As previously communicated, Rowing Australia and Rowing WA (event host) recognise the extra strain that the current fuel crisis has put on clubs, crews and individuals to make the decision to attend the 2026 AMRC.
Rowing WA has been reaching out to clubs across the country to gain insights into interest for the event and has been pleasantly surprised with the response. West Australians are sued to the long trip across the country for regattas, so acknowledge the effort this requires.
Concerns raised from clubs around the country have been related to fuel cost, fuel availability, and whether travelling during a fuel crisis is the right thing to do. To ease the burden of the additional costs to compete at the 2026 AMRC, predominantly associated with getting trailers across the country, Rowing WA has established a Trailer Subsidy Scheme, providing opportunity for those towing trailers from states outside of WA to apply for a subsidy to offset the additional fuel costs. Subsidies vary depending on what capital city you are travelling from and come with some conditions. These conditions include being a reasonable sized trailer with a reasonable number of boats on board.
The Trailer Subsidy Scheme is capped and applications will be assessed on a first come first served basis. However, based on previous AMRC’s hosted in WA, we believe there is capacity under the scheme for all trailers travelling from interstate to access a subsidy.
The intent of the scheme is to support more trailers to come to WA, to make the 2026 AMRC the best event possible.

Applications close at 5pm AWST Monday 4 May 2026. Successful applicants will be advised via email by COB 5pm AWST Tuesday 5 May.
